Your team
This role is part of the Transfer Operations team based out of India office. You will work within a global client services function, processing Stocks & shares ISA, Cash ISA and Share dealing transfers while ensuring seamless custody management for IG's clients across EMEA or APAC regions.
Your role in the Team’s Success
We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Associate Analyst to become a key member of our welcoming and collaborative Stock Transfer Team. In this role, you will play a crucial part in ensuring the accurate and timely processing of stock transfer cases, contributing to our commitment to excellence.
What you’ll do
Key responsibilities:
Process Stock Transfers: Efficiently manage the transfer of assets in and out of IG.
Perform all tasks related to stock transfers i.e reviewing transfer form for errors, entering instructions in IG's systems, performing settlement checks and monitoring end to end request until closure.
Client Communication: Proactively follow up with clients and brokers on transfer cases through calls and emails.
Issue Resolution: Address client inquiries and collaborate with internal teams to resolve issues.
Quality Control: Conduct thorough reviews of instructions in the systems to ensure accuracy.
System Management: Update and maintain internal systems with accurate information.
Escalation Handling: Manage escalations from clients and internal stakeholders professionally.
Regulatory Compliance: Ensure all stock transfer processes meet regulatory requirements.
